Cat Allergies: Can you build up an immunity to cat allergies

Some people are lucky enough that they eventually develop an immunity to cat allergies While this is certainly possible, allergic reactions may also worsen with more exposure. It’s also possible that someone who has never suffered an allergy to cats before can develop one.

Can you be allergic to one cat and not another?


Allergic:

Can you be allergic to some cats and not others? Different cats produce varying levels of Fel d 1, so allergy sufferers may find that they are allergic to some cats and not others In addition, everyone’s sensitivity level to this allergen is different.

Short Haired Cats Better: Are short haired cats better for allergies

A common misconception is that cat allergic individuals are allergic to cat hair and that long haired cats are more allergenic than short haired cats. However, this is no the case Cat allergy does not come from the hair itself, but from proteins which stick on the hair.

Do some cats cause more allergies than others?


Cats:

The types and amount of cat allergen produced can vary significantly between individual cats, and people may react more severely to one particular cat over another Such differences in allergen production are not related to the length of hair or breed of cat.
